Considerations for Use

While the Faux Stitch Embroidery Letters Numbers is a beautiful design, there are a few key considerations to keep in mind when using it on different products. Due to its delicate nature, it may not be the best fit for thick towels, stretchy fabrics, or curved surfaces. Additionally, small lettering and intricate details require careful placement and proper stabilization to ensure they remain intact after stitching.

Dark fabrics can also pose a challenge, as the contrast between the thread color and the background may not be as pronounced. It’s always a good idea to test the design on a scrap piece of fabric before proceeding with the final product. Practical Tips for Embroidery Success

To ensure the best results when using the Faux Stitch Embroidery Letters Numbers, follow these practical tips:

  1. Test on Scrap Fabric: Always test the design on a scrap piece of fabric to assess how it looks and performs before using it on your final product.
  2. Check Thread Color Contrast: Ensure the thread color provides sufficient contrast against the fabric to maintain clarity and visibility.
  3. Confirm Hoop Size: Make sure your hoop size is appropriate for the design to avoid distortion or uneven stitching.
  4. Review Stitch Density: Adjust the stitch density based on the fabric type and desired outcome for optimal results.
  5. Use Proper Stabilizer: A high-quality stabilizer will help maintain the integrity of the design, especially on delicate or stretchy fabrics.
  6. Compare Light and Dark Fabric Mockups: Create printable mockups to see how the design appears on both light and dark fabrics.
  7. Check Small Details After Stitching: Inspect the finished product closely for any missed details or inconsistencies.
  8. Confirm Commercial Licensing: If you plan to sell finished products, verify that the design allows for commercial use.
